​Another record-breaking ISE show has come to an end and we are more than excited to see and be part of the rapid advances in high quality video display and transport. 

This year 1300 exhibitors used the show to display and introduce their technologies to more than 80.000 visitors. 


Out of all the highlights presented, these have specifically caught our eye:


TICO -> JPEG-XS in its final stages!

During his speech on Friday, video compression expert Francois-Pierre Clouet presented the latest advances of our TICO compression technology and its involvement in the upcoming JPEG-XS standard. Read more about the future game-changer JPEG-XS.

8K projection is already a thing!

At a time when only the first 4K projectors are coming in at affordable prices, ISE this year was stage to the first commercially available 8K projector. While 8K video transport is still seen as troublesome, solutions are actually not hard to implement. Read more ...

ProAV and Broadcast are drawing closer together.

With video over IP becoming more popular in both industries, new standards such as the SMPTE ST2110 are simplifying the switch to IP for creating managed IP network infrastructures. Macnica and intoPIX displayed a joint demo on the Xilinx booth for bandwidth-efficient AV over IP transmission systems. Missed it? Read more here ...

Crestron's DM NVX remains unbeaten thanks to JPEG 2000 ULL

Running with standard COTS 1GB Ethernet switches thanks to our innovative JPEG2000 ULL IP-cores, DM NVX's latency stays benchmark in its segment. On their booth, Crestron showcased a direct comparison to comparable solutions. See for yourself ...
